THE BOARDROOM co-working has announced the opening of two new offices in Pune. The two modern facilities cover a total area of 36,000 sq-ft. This is asignificant milestone in THE BOARDROOM’s journey of entering a new market and empowering professionals and businesses in Pune.
In the Baner area of Pune, THE BOARDROOM will have a total space of more than 36,000 sq-ft, adding around 800 seats. The Pride Gateway & SBC (Sadanand Business Center) offices make it an ideal managed office space for MNCs, IT companies, and other new-age companies. Both locations offer a plethora of modern amenities, collaborative workspaces, and an inspiring environment that fosters creativity and productivity, promising an exciting new work experience.

India’s total penetration of the flex market is estimated to be around 6.5%, higher than the APAC region, which stands at 2 to 3%. In 2024, the flex market is estimated to grow around 60% to about Rs 14,000 crore, as per a study done by Upflex. The co-working industry is not just growing; it’s booming. With a 43% increase in transactions recorded in the first quarter of this year compared to last year, the demand for flexible workspace solutions is at an all-time high. This surge in demand underscores the value proposition offered by co-working spaces, which provide cost-effective and flexible workspace solutions for companies of all sizes. Pune, known for its dynamic business landscape, has emerged as a frontrunner. According to recent data from Knight Frank India, the city leads in flex space transactions, with 1.2 lakh square feet transacted in the first quarter of this year alone. This surge in demand reflects the growing preference for co-working spaces among companies and independent professionals.
